OBD Guide

U0404

Invalid Data Received From Gear Shift Control Module A

U0404 is an OBD-II diagnostic trouble code meaning: Invalid Data Received From Gear Shift Control Module A. Common causes: shift module malfunction, damage to the wiring harness between modules. Estimated repair cost: $56–278.

Severity
⚠️ Medium
Can you drive?
Limited driving only, diagnose soon
Approx. repair cost
$56–278 (est.)

Symptoms

  • Incorrect gear shifting
  • Check Engine Light Illuminates
  • Transmission of the gearbox into emergency mode
  • Loss of engine power
  • Problems with cruise control

Causes

  • Shift module malfunction
  • Damage to the wiring harness between modules
  • Oxidation of contacts in connectors
  • TCM power supply problems
  • Software errors in ECU or TCM

How to Fix

  1. Check TCM connections and connectors
  2. Scan the system for other errors
  3. Check the integrity of the wiring between the modules
  4. Update module software
  5. Replace the gear shift module if necessary

Related codes

Error U0404 by Vehicle Brand

FAQ

What does the U0404 code mean?

U0404 is an OBD-II diagnostic trouble code that indicates: Invalid Data Received From Gear Shift Control Module A

What causes a U0404 error code?

The most common causes of U0404 include: Shift module malfunction; Damage to the wiring harness between modules; Oxidation of contacts in connectors; TCM power supply problems.

How do I fix a U0404 diagnostic trouble code?

To fix U0404: Check TCM connections and connectors. Scan the system for other errors. Check the integrity of the wiring between the modules. For a complete diagnosis, use an OBD-II scanner.

Is it safe to drive with U0404?

Limited driving only, diagnose soon

How much does it cost to fix U0404?

The estimated repair cost for U0404 is $56–278. Actual cost depends on your vehicle, location, and labor rates.

See also: Russian version · NationStat